Fig 7. Kidney cell damage is not accompanied by high plasma levels of proinflammatory molecules.

Subgroup analysis (a, b, c) compares pooled subgroups for the semiquantative score for proximal tubular cell granulation (ptc) in hematoxylin eosin (HE) stained slices at 400:1 enlargement with the plasma levels of proinflammatory mediators. A further subgroup analysis was performed using loss of cell barrier as criterion of cell damage (d, e, f). The values are presented as boxplots (median/25th/75th percentile/ outliers). Pairs of symbols mark p < 0.05.
